Analysis
The most recent figure for other — emissions in Brunei Darussalam is 0.0701 kt, measured in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.3% on the previous year and up 19.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, other — emissions in Brunei Darussalam peaked at 0.0858 kt in 2008 and was at its lowest, 0.0052 kt, in 1961.
That places Brunei Darussalam 162nd out of 198 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
